当前位置: 首页 > news >正文

免费额度哪家强?ESP32玩家实测八大国产大模型API(含通义千问、Kimi、DeepSeek)

ESP32开发者指南:八大国产大模型API横向评测与实战选型

当ESP32遇上大语言模型,会擦出怎样的火花?在物联网设备上直接运行AI交互功能,已经成为越来越多开发者的新选择。但面对众多国产大模型API,如何选择最适合ESP32项目的解决方案?本文将从实战角度出发,对通义千问、Kimi、DeepSeek等八大主流模型进行全方位评测,帮助开发者找到性价比最高的AI搭档。

1. 评测框架与方法论

我们建立了严格的四维评测体系,确保测试结果客观可比:

  • 硬件环境:统一使用ESP32-C3开发板(合宙经典版),Arduino IDE 2.3.2开发环境
  • 网络条件:固定连接5GHz WiFi频段,网络延迟稳定在15ms以内
  • 测试脚本:基于修改版HTTPClient库,每个API连续调用100次取平均值
  • 评估维度
    evaluation_metrics = { 'response_time': '从请求发送到完整接收响应的时间', 'error_rate': 'HTTP非200响应的比例', 'token_usage': '实际消耗的输入输出token数', 'context_awareness': '对对话历史的记忆能力' }

提示:所有测试均在厂商提供的免费额度内完成,避免因计费策略差异影响结果

2. 核心性能横向对比

2.1 响应速度与稳定性

通过批量测试获取的基准数据如下:

模型名称平均响应时间(ms)99分位延迟(ms)错误率(%)
Kimi120021000.8
通义千问Turbo180032001.2
DeepSeek250048002.5
讯飞星火160029001.8
智谱清言220041003.1
豆包95018000.5
MiniMax140026001.0
腾讯混元200035002.0

从数据可见,豆包以950ms的平均响应时间夺冠,特别适合实时交互场景。而Kimi在保持第二快速度的同时,长文本处理能力更为突出。

2.2 免费额度政策解析

各平台的免费策略直接影响开发成本:

  1. 讯飞星火:1亿token/月(最慷慨)
  2. 通义千问:800万token/日(按日重置)
  3. 智谱清言:300万token/月(中等额度)
  4. MiniMax:500万token/月(含图片生成)
  5. 豆包/Kimi:50万token/月(适合轻量使用)
// Token计算示例(通义千问) int estimateCost(String input) { int chineseChars = input.length(); // 中文字符≈1token int extraTokens = 30; // 系统预设token return chineseChars + extraTokens; }

注意:部分平台会对高频访问实施限流,建议在ESP32代码中加入随机延迟

3. ESP32适配实战技巧

3.1 内存优化方案

ESP32的有限内存(通常512KB)对大模型响应处理是主要挑战。推荐采用流式解析策略:

void handleStreamResponse(WiFiClient &client) { String partialResponse; while(client.connected()) { if(client.available()) { char c = client.read(); if(c == '\n') { processChunk(partialResponse); // 分段处理 partialResponse = ""; } else { partialResponse += c; } } } }

3.2 各平台SDK适配对比

模型必要库文件内存占用(KB)推荐开发板
通义千问ArduinoJson v645ESP32-C3
KimiWiFiClientSecure38ESP32-S3
DeepSeekHTTPClient52ESP32-C6
讯飞星火BearSSL60ESP32-S2

实测发现,Kimi的API设计对资源最为友好,而星火需要额外的SSL证书处理。

4. 场景化选型建议

4.1 实时对话场景

推荐组合:豆包API + ESP32-S3

优势分析:

  • 950ms的超低延迟
  • 支持SSE流式传输
  • 简单的JSON响应结构

配置示例:

// 豆包精简请求体 String buildDoubaoPayload(String input) { return "{\"messages\":[{\"role\":\"user\",\"content\":\"" + input + "\"}]}"; }

4.2 长文本处理场景

推荐方案:Kimi + ESP32-C6

独特优势:

  • 支持128K上下文
  • 自动摘要生成能力
  • 分段响应处理

实测在处理5000字文档时,Kimi能保持上下文连贯性,而其他模型会出现信息丢失。

5. 异常处理与调试

收集了300+次测试中的典型问题:

  • QPS限制:通义千问免费版限制5QPS,建议添加:
    delay(random(200, 500)); // 随机延迟
  • 内存溢出:智谱清言的长响应可能导致崩溃,需要:
    #define JSON_BUFFER_SIZE 8192 // 扩大缓冲区
  • WiFi断连:DeepSeek响应时间长,建议:
    WiFi.setAutoReconnect(true);

在合宙ESP32-C3上,豆包和Kimi的稳定性最佳,连续运行72小时无异常重启。

6. 进阶优化方向

对于需要更高性能的项目,可以考虑:

  1. 二进制协议:MiniMax支持protobuf格式,体积减少40%
  2. 本地缓存:对固定问答对进行SPIFFS存储
  3. 模型蒸馏:使用平台提供的轻量版模型
// SPIFFS缓存示例 void saveToCache(String query, String response) { File file = SPIFFS.open("/cache/" + hashQuery(query), "w"); file.print(response); file.close(); }

经过两个月实际项目验证,Kimi在综合评分中脱颖而出,特别是在多轮对话场景下。而预算有限的开发者可以优先考虑讯飞星火,其免费额度足以支撑大多数原型开发。

http://www.jsqmd.com/news/856013/

相关文章:

  • 用Transformer搞定多模态步态识别:手把手教你复现CVPR 2023的MMGaitFormer(附代码)
  • 2026年热门的插件生产线/倍速生产线/浙江烘道生产线厂家综合对比分析 - 行业平台推荐
  • 告别VS Code C++插件卡顿:用Clangd+CMake打造丝滑的嵌入式代码补全环境(附完整配置流程)
  • 从DICOM到3D打印:手把手教你用3D Slicer处理医学影像全流程(含STL导出)
  • 如何通过 IDEA 远程部署 Spring Boot 项目到 Linux 服务器?
  • 别再只会拖模块了!用Simulink S-Function把C++算法集成到模型里的保姆级教程
  • 别再自己造轮子了!手把手教你用LwRB环形缓冲区搞定嵌入式数据流(附DMA零拷贝实战)
  • 不只是跑通Demo:用Isaac Gym和Legged_Gym训练四足机器人,我遇到的5个实战问题与调优心得
  • 废水监测设备哪家强?江苏做监测设备运维的公司有哪些?COD氨氮重金属水质监测设备厂家盘点,认准江苏卓正 - 栗子测评
  • 别再只读原始值了!MPU6050数据滤波与姿态解算入门:用STM32实现简易角度估算
  • 用FPGA的DDS IP核做个信号发生器:从Vivado配置到ILA抓波形实战
  • 从Simulink到C代码:手把手教你移植一阶ESO到嵌入式MCU(附完整工程)
  • 别再为画图发愁了!手把手教你用开源神器draw.io搞定流程图和数学公式
  • Linux开发内功:高效工具链与项目布局实战指南
  • 保姆级教程:用YOLOv8和公开数据集(UA-DETRAC/BIT-Vehicle)快速搭建车辆检测系统
  • 2026年知名的浙江生产线/插件生产线/生产线/倍速生产线可靠供应商推荐 - 品牌宣传支持者
  • 告别降级!PyTorch 1.13.1 + CUDA 11.6 下搞定 Mask R-CNN/Faster R-CNN 的 THC 依赖报错(保姆级修复)
  • 从MVC到DDD:微服务架构下应对业务复杂性的实战演进
  • 从原理图到PCB:手把手教你设计一个支持CAN总线的程控电阻箱(STM32方案)
  • 华为eNSP实验避坑指南:搞定MSTP+VRRP+OSPF多协议联动时最常见的5个报错
  • 保姆级教程:用PlatformIO给ESP32刷Marlin固件,搞定WiFi配置和Web界面
  • 别再傻傻分不清!GDT、TSS、TVS、ESD这四种保护器件,到底怎么选?(附选型速查表)
  • Perplexity概念解释功能终极手册(含PyTorch/TensorFlow原生实现+Hugging Face源码级调试技巧)
  • 2026年4月市场优秀的滚轮轴承供应商推荐,滚针轴承/不锈钢滚针轴承/连铸机耐高温轴承/单向轴承,滚轮轴承厂商哪家好 - 品牌推荐师
  • 2026年抗静电的PVC型材/电器用PVC型材/PVC异型材厂家推荐与选型指南 - 品牌宣传支持者
  • ARMv8-A架构LDP与LDR内存加载指令详解
  • 2026年靠谱的广东复合牛皮纸/广东牛皮纸主流厂家对比评测 - 品牌宣传支持者
  • 嵌入式系统开发实战:从硬件选型到软件编程的完整指南
  • 避坑指南:树莓派4B + PCA9685驱动舵机,电源供电和I2C报错‘Remote I/O error’的完整解决方案
  • 2026年靠谱的复合床垫牛皮纸/家具沙发牛皮纸与床垫编织袋/广东牛皮纸/复合牛皮纸多家厂家对比分析 - 行业平台推荐